💻 Brave lanzará Brave Origin con polémica El famoso navegador Brave ha anunciado el lanzamiento de Brave Origin, una nueva variante de su navegador centrada en la simplicidad y la privacidad. Esta edición se presenta como una opción “debloated" del navegador estándar, en la que se eliminan de forma permanente características no esenciales para la navegación básica, la privacidad y la seguridad. Según la información disponible en los repositorios de Brave y comentarios de sus desarrolladores, Brave Origin suprime promociones internas, anuncios de marca, el sistema de recompensas BAT, el asistente de inteligencia artificial Leo, el monedero cripto integrado, VPN y otras funciones adicionales que se han incorporado con el tiempo al navegador principal. ¿Y cual es la polémica? Que solo es gratuito para Linux. Pues al parecer, para usuarios de Windows, MacOS y otras plataformas los precios van entre 59.99$ y 69.99$. Creo que nos hemos acostumbrado a tenerlo todo gratuito y ni siquiera es obligatorio adquirirlo, puedes usar el navegador Brave como siempre.


🛑 108 Chrome extensions with 20,000 installs were tied to one backend stealing user data. They captured Google accounts, hijacked Telegram sessions, and injected scripts into every page—while posing as games and utilities. 🔗Read → thehackernews.com/2026/04/108-ma…
